Events
Figure 47: Main menu – Events
Figure 48: Events screen
Soft keys
1.
No function
2.
PREVIOUS – Go to the previous page of more recent tightenings. When on the first page,
this key will be blank.
3.
NEXT [ENT] – Go to the next page of older tightenings. When on the last page, this key
will be blank.
4.
RETURN [ESC] – Returns to the Run Screen.
The Events screen shows the log of non-tightening events that have occurred. More information
is available via the PC software application. This screen shows:
•
Time – The time the event occurred. The date is indicated at the top of the table and each
time it changes. The current time is shown at the bottom of the screen for comparison.
•
Code – The event code for this event.
•
Event – The name of this event.
•
Source – The source that caused the event.
•
Status – The status of the event. 0 indicates success, non-zero indicates an error.
